Orange
Orange Holiday SIM card is a great option for travelers in Europe. It comes with 30GB of 4G data, and unlimited calls and text messages. The SIM is also available in eSIM form so you can download it before your trip. It is available on the Orange website or in Orange stores or Relay stores, which are typically located in airports. The eSIM allows you to travel with your smartphone and avoid roaming fees.
Orange launched in 1994 in 1994, promising to make mobiles affordable for everyone. It was a bold proposition at an era when mobile phones were still considered to be flashy devices by bankers. Its name was a play on the words of the fruit, and was unusual in the industry. The brand was built by an in-house team led by Hans Snook and Chris Moss, and it had a distinctive identity and slogan that read "The future is bright and the future is orange."
Hutchison Whampoa purchased Microtel Communications Ltd. in 1990. The following year, they renamed the company Orange Personal Communications Services Ltd and introduced the first GSM 1800 MHz network. The company was a publicly limited company until the year 2000 when it was purchased by France Telecom for PS2bn.
The Orange brand continued to be used worldwide, including in france online shopping sites clothes, Germany and Italy. In 2010 the UK business merged with T-Mobile which was owned by Deutsche Telekom, to create EE. The company has since switched its focus to 4G and is now investing billions in it. The name is fading in the UK and the company is now selling EE products in its 600 high-street shops.
Orange sponsored the Baftas and the Women's Prize for Fiction. Millions of pounds were spent on sponsorships. The sponsorship of these events by Orange was later ended. Orange sponsored Wednesdays in cinemas. This meant that Orange customers could get two tickets for the price of one. The commitment of the brand to cinema was evident in its iconic ads with stars like Dennis Hopper, Macaulay Culkin and Carrie Fisher.

Jamster
It's hard to pick up an iPhone in the UK without seeing an advertisement for Jamster however, the company has been hit with a scathing criticism from the Advertising Standards Authority (ASA). The company ran ads that featured its ringtone and mobile wallpaper characters Crazy Frog and Sweetie the Chick however, many users complained that the ads were inaccurate.
The complaint states that the ads misled consumers by suggesting that they would receive free ringtones when they sent a text message to a short code that was shown in the advertisement. In fact, the company imposed recurring premium short message service charges on the consumers' monthly cellphone bills. The company charged for multiple messages even though consumers hadn't downloaded any ringtone.
The terms and conditions were not clearly defined. Those who received the bill weren't informed of the fact that the service was a subscription-based. The advertising company's practices violated ASA guidelines, and it has been ordered to stop using the characters in future TV commercials.
Jamster is owned by VeriSign and sells ringtones as well as other content to mobile subscribers. The company's mobile services are available in the United States and Europe, and it also offers music streaming to PCs and digital televisions.
The wallpaper and ringtones such as Sweetie the Chick, Crazy Frog and Anna Blue, have been popular in Germany and have even made it into a PlayStation 2 videogame. Some customers, however, complain that the company's wallpaper and ringtone services are unreliable and expensive. Some customers have complained about being charged for items that weren't downloaded. Others have complained that customer service representatives of the company are insensitive to complaints. Despite these issues most people favor this service. The mobile service is available in Germany and the United Kingdom. There are several different plans available.
